Well now is your chance to prove it, as Universal Pictures, Wired Magazine & Lone Shark Games has just launched an official REPO MEN Hunt. What exactly does such a “hunt” entail? Read on…

First off, it’s probably best to contextualize the hunt with the plot of Miguel Sapchnik’s sci-fi thriller (REPO MEN):

In the future humans have extended and improved our lives through highly sophisticated and expensive mechanical organs created by a company called “The Union”. The dark side of these medical breakthroughs is that if you don’t pay your bill, “The Union” sends its highly skilled repo men to take back its property… with no concern for your comfort or survival. Former soldier Remy is one of the best organ repo men in the business. But when he suffers a cardiac failure on the job, he awakens to find himself fitted with the company’s top-of-the-line heart-replacement… as well as a hefty debt. But a side effect of the procedure is that his heart’s no longer in the job. When he can’t make the payments, The Union sends its toughest enforcer, Remy’s former partner Jake, to track him down.

So…in a pretty cool sounding promo tie-in with the film, starting today, four Runners, with a $7,500 bounty on each of their heads, kicked off a first-of-its-kind event to find out what it’s like to be hunted – and YOU can do the hunting. The Union is offering select men and women the opportunity to join their exclusive force of repo experts.

The Repo Men must use the internet, their wits, and any other legal means possible to find anyone in possession of an artificial organ [artiforg]. Any Repo Man claiming and returning an artiforg to The Union will receive a payment of $7,500 per artiforg returned.

By my quick math, that’s a cool $30,000 up for grabs. Not bad in this economy, ay?

So what do you have to do to join the hunt? Readers over the age of 18 can sign up at www.wired.com/repomen to become Repo Men, unlock the clues and track down the Runners. Whoever is able to locate a Runner in person, take his or her photo and say a code word will win $7,500. Any Runner who lasts a month without being caught stands to gain up to $10,000. The Runners will be operating under a series of constraints and challenges, and Runners and Repo Men alike are forbidden from breaking the law. Clues will be hidden at every turn.

The contest begins today and continues until 12:01 A.M. on March 25, or when the Repo Men capture all of the runners—whichever comes first. The Hunt’s Runners include Ciji, who has spent hours imagining how she’d disguise herself; Usman, whose whereabouts shift with Heisenbergian uncertainty; Alex, a self-described “smart, sassy, athletic girl who loves adventure”; and Will, a former Army soldier who trained NATO forces in SERE (Survive, Evade, Resist and Escape) school.
